Transaction 18fc31d1578fc5fa7ee5a90e527a9dcb9892b1bfb8f79f5c48d318bb911a19f9
1 Input
1 Output
-
18fc31d1578fc5fa7ee5a90e527a9dcb9892b1bfb8f79f5c48d318bb911a19f9:0
- value
- 152594934
- script pubkey
- OP_0 OP_PUSHBYTES_20 26ca514d266766421243c745c0e00ee3de12b248
- address
- bc1qym99znfxvanyyyjrcazupcqwu00p9vjghnnx7a